Planning Calendars can help
YOU accomplish your educational goals!
Instructions:
Get a Weekly Schedule Planning Sheet and set it up as
follows—
- Your name and dates in
the week are written at the top of the page.
- Using a RED pen, draw
vertical lines midway through the middle of each daily column…top of the
grid to the bottom. This will
divide each daily column into two sections.
- Still using the red pen, on the left-hand side of each column, PLAN your
day. Write 1-3 words describing the activity you plan to do. Example: “UP”, “EAT”, “MATH p. 43”,
“Engl. Pers. Para.”, etc.
- If an activity will
take longer than an hour, draw a line through the next box—stopping when
you think the activity will be concluded.
- At the bottom of the
page, write in the time you PLAN to go to sleep.
- Complete the planning
calendar for the entire week.
- DAILY…use your calendar
to guide your day. The right-hand
side of each column is where you write in CHANGES to your plan; do this in
black, blue or color other than RED.
If there’s no change in your plan, leave the right-hand box BLANK.
- Attach completed
calendars and paragraphs to this cover sheet
